In-phase axial T2-weighted (T2W) (a), water only T2W (b), and T1-weighted (T1W) fat-suppressed contrast enhanced (c) images show a 1.5 × 1.3 × 2.3 cm sized intraosseous lesion with endosteal scalloping and peripheral enhancement. The lesion extended through cortical breach (white arrowheads) with enhancing extraosseous component (white arrow)Back to article page
